An overland Brazil to Guyana Fibre Optic Cable that was built in 2011 has been abandoned due to extensive damage. It was largely established by foreign media companies. Prime Minister Bridgadier (Ret'd) Mark Phillips commissioned a new multi-billion-dollar direct submarine fibre-optic cable, marking a historic moment for the region and closing the long-standing digital gap between the coastland and the hinterland. Internet penetration has risen to 78%, reflecting increased adoption of digital services.

Fiber optic cables have Kevlar aramid yarn or a fiberglass rod as their strength member. You should pull on the fiber cable strength members only! Never exceed the maximum pulling load rating. On long runs, use proper lubricants and make sure they are compatible with the cable jacket. The cable should be bent as little as possible.
